IP查询
查询
你查询的IP:[203.89.95.99] 地理位置:澳大利亚
最新查询
221.16.10.170
202.127.152.129
119.133.25.13
119.166.161.77
120.100.171.167
218.40.29.240
119.109.90.1
119.95.30.127
221.198.0.46
203.89.95.99
121.101.208.100
221.44.213.232
117.103.128.97
203.176.168.144
117.21.18.178
119.59.128.30
116.199.128.163
121.201.44.229
58.128.196.153
119.40.128.100
202.189.80.95
202.131.48.232
117.106.117.6
119.10.157.33
202.38.192.138
61.28.137.191
203.175.192.3
119.48.194.70
203.100.192.50
121.32.204.137
116.194.101.209